The wood was gathered with respect from an ancient spring in southern Britain, held sacred for millennia and with links to the Old Ways and associations with fertility. The spring is one of the sources of the River Itchen whose name has connections with a pre-Roman Goddess, Ica. Very little written information exists about her today, but Ica is a Goddess truly of the ancient land in this area and there is still a strong sense of her at the spring.
